Square (スクエア Sukuea) is the place where Z/X, Z/X Extra, and Z/X Overboost cards are played in the playing field.
There are 2 different type of Square, Normal Square and Player Square, with the latter also double as the place for Player Card. The playing field itself is composed of 9 Squares (2 Player Square and 7 Normal Square) in a 3×3 grid, further divided into 3 different area based on their position to the player—Army Area, Center Area, and Enemy Army Area.
Once a Z/X is played and put on a Square, it cannot be moved onto another Square, except by a card ability. Most card abilities or effects affect Z/X on Square, and often specifically designates which Square it affects, either by mentioning the Square type or by using the Square Designation Diagram.
Comprehensive Rules
303 Square
303.1 Zone where the cards with Player and Z/X, Z/X Extra, or Z/X Overboost card type are placed.
303.2 Square is shared by both player, there are 9 Squares in total, lined up in 3×3 grid. Vertically or horizontally adjacent Squares are both Square next to each other. Diagonally adjacent Squares are not.
303.2a The meaning of distance from a certain Square to another Square, and also as a reference, is the smallest amount of Squares that able to reach the other Square, counting from the Square next to that certain Square.
Example : Distance to the next Square is 1.
Example : Distance to the diagonally positioned Square is 2.
303.3 All Squares is either a Normal Square or a Player Square.
303.3a Among the Squares, the 2 Squares that was vertically adjacent to the middle Square are Player Square.
303.3b Among the Squares, the 7 Squares that are not a Player Square are Normal Square.
303.4 Squares may belong to groups called Area.
303.4a For a player, their own Player Square (402.1a), as well as Squares next to it except the middle one, belong to Army Area.
303.4b For a player, the opponent's Player Square (402.1a), as well as Squares next to it except the middle one, belong to Enemy Army Area.
303.4c Squares that does not belong to Army Area or Enemy Army Area belong to Center Area.
303.5 Cards put on Square has either Reboot or Sleep State (302.2).
303.5a If a card is put on Square from anywhere except from Square, it is put in Reboot State.
303.6 If a text refer to "Z/X" without specifying a particular zone, it refer to cards with Z/X, Z/X Extra, and Z/X Overboost card type on Square. Similarly, if a text refer to "Player" without specifying a particular zone, it refer to cards with Player card type on Square.
303.6a If any effect try to move a card with Player card type to other Square, that card does not move.
303.7 Square is a public zone. It is possible to arbitrarily change the order of cards in your control that you put on Square.
